“Intersex” by Megan Potter

The anticipation to recognize is human nature. This society instantly assigns identity or one becomes nonexistent and forgotten. It is proper to give a label despite the consequences that loom over it. When someone makes the choice, we cannot change it. There is no option to go against it. A name is a name and a shape is a shape. And I,— well I am what somebody said I was.

Why can’t a star be a heart?

Because somebody said so.
